#3e3782 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#3e3782 is composed of 24.3% red, 21.6% green and 51%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 52.3% cyan, 57.7% magenta, 0% yellow and 49% black. It has a hue angle of 245.6 degrees, a saturation of 40.5% and a lightness of 36.3%. #3e3782 color hex could be obtained by blending #7c6eff with #000005. Closest websafe color is: #333399.

Shades and Tints of #3e3782
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030306 is the darkest color, while #f8f7fc is the lightest one.

Tones of #3e3782
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#5b5b5e is the less saturated color, while #1505b4 is the most saturated one.
